WebThe Standardized Precipitation Index (SPI) is a widely used index to characterize meteorological drought on a range of timescales. On short timescales, the SPI is closely related to soil moisture, while at longer timescales, the SPI can be related to groundwater and reservoir storage. WebThe values quantifying the intensity of drought and signaling the beginning and end of a drought or wet spell were arbitrarily selected based on Palmer’s study of central Iowa and western Kansas and have little scientific meaning. The Palmer Index is sensitive to the available water content (AWC) of a soil type. WebDrought is a natural hazard that inflicts costly damage to the environment and human communities.
